Amazing how low you can clock it down. I had the clock crystal down to the Kilohertz range and it was still sampling.
I don't know why more old school samplers didn't do that: Sample at a relatively low rate and then use pitch shifting to effectively increase your sampling time with a quality trade off. You get a lot more time and for grit, it's pretty useful. I know that a lot of manufacturers were trying to get as high quality samples as possible, but it's still interesting.
